Parts of your plantation shutter
Traditional plantation shutters use a relatively easy design. Plantation shutters normally are made up of some total-size vertical sections, and can be divided into four principal parts:
The horizontal panels found on the top rated and underside in the shutter are referred to as the 'rails'. Some plantation shutters can also have one or higher horizontal side rails in the center of the shutter, dividing the plantation shutter into individual divisions.
Located on the edges from the shutter, are straight 'stiles'.
'Louvers' would be the parallel panels located in between the stiles, which can be tilted and modified allowing in more or less light. Louvers can be produced in several numerous shapes and sizes.
The 'tilt rod' will be the process which manages the activity of your louvers. These come in a variety of styles.
Single tilt rods are one steady, top to bottom rod hooking up and controlling all the louvers concurrently.
A divided tilt rod is just that: a lean rod split into personal sections. This allows independent control over many divisions located on one shutter board, for example, modifying the very best tier allowing in additional light-weight, while keeping a cheaper tier's louvers sealed, for privacy.
Hidden lean rods enable the device to get discreetly hidden behind the shutter board.
Where by performed plantation shutters come from?
Shutters have already been useful for many, several ages. Some industry experts claim that they were applied as far back as historic Greece, with panels simply being made out of marble pieces. These were used before glass was offered, to provide defense against the elements, like bad weather, wind flow, and primary warmth from your sun's sun rays. They also effectively guarded against pesky insects and small wildlife entering the building. The true function of the shutters was treasured when these elements and unwanted pests transferred, and also the shutters might be opened up, allowing for refreshing sunshine plus a amazing wind to ventilate the business.
Many older The southern area of homes found the beauty and practicality of those shutters, integrating them to the design of the decadent mansions seen on plantations in the Outdated Southern. The phrase 'plantation shutter' was produced by these applications. These shutters have experienced remarkably couple of modifications because these very early instances.
Modern day plantation shutters
Right now, plantation shutters can be found in a huge selection of styles, styles, and materials. They can be found through the entire globe, in every single style of home. Most are constructed with hardwoods for example poplar or largemouth bass and can a have numerous coatings to incorporate structural appeal to residential and commercial components. Plantation shutters manufactured from rich forests for example cherry, oak, mahogany, or walnut are exceptionally appealing.
Plantation shutters can be utilized one by one, or associated together to cover numerous windows, or one big one. Numerous suppliers of plantation shutters permit you to get customized shutters built to your specs to include a unique look to your home and make a design assertion.
Today's plantation shutters still provide you with the numerous practicalities that previous years discovered so beneficial. Plantation shutters are fully adaptable to allow for more or less light-weight, supply privacy, and may even have insulation positive aspects.
